Transaction 17aaf6579594d42d8cbe6aa9b16fcba90f24e8845255d0c9134efc5fb0f5b74a
1 Input
1 Output
-
17aaf6579594d42d8cbe6aa9b16fcba90f24e8845255d0c9134efc5fb0f5b74a:0
- value
- 420973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d15ec51a8f24dcbff91808c505b4ceba592162f1 OP_EQUAL
- address
- 3Ln4gNEdjTVmUAV5ao1daWXkPb1JNZtdrZ